WORST THEN ZIP TIES
Although they expand nicely to fit onto the chicks leg. As the chick grows the elastic no longer expands and by 3 weeks old there is already a dent in the chicks leg. As it continues to grow it will full slice into their leg worst then a zip tie. A zip tie is thick enough that it stays exposed longer. The thiness of the elastic allows the skin to quickly start to grow over it but it still just embeds in their leg. WORST THEN ZIP TIES

For my Zebra Finches
I got these for my Finches because I've read about problems that normal leg bands can cause, and I mostly wanted these to tell my birds apart. The bands are easy to put on and if need be; cut off. They are a bit roomy, but not so much that they fall off. Most of my birds had no problems with the bands, a few do tug on them but the bands haven't snapped yet. They may break if your bird is determined enough to get it off. They are too big for Finch chicks, so they will have to be put on adult sized Finches. If your Finches don't like to be handled it can be a challenge to put the bands on by yourself.

Only good for first week
These only work when the chicks are first born for identification. As the chicks grow the rubber will not stretch enough and cut into chicks leg. if you don't take them off within the first week they will harm the chicken. I would not put these on a chick in the future if you forgot or missed seeing it, you would end up causing the chick to lose its leg or die
